How Timing Affects Processing

Your circadian rhythm controls how your body processes sugar and fat throughout the day. In the morning, cortisol and growth hormone naturally peak, priming your metabolism to handle glucose efficiently.

Dark chocolate contains flavonoids that enhance insulin sensitivity — but only when your body is metabolically active. These compounds work with your natural hormone cycles to improve blood sugar control.

When you eat chocolate in the evening, your metabolism is winding down for sleep. The same flavonoids that help in the morning can actually interfere with melatonin production and disrupt glucose processing overnight.

The Optimal Chocolate Window

The optimal chocolate window is 7 AM to 2 PM, with the sweet spot being within two hours of waking. Your cortisol levels are naturally highest in the morning, making your body most efficient at processing the natural sugars in dark chocolate.

Choose chocolate with at least 70% cacao content for maximum flavonoid benefits. Lower percentages contain too much added sugar, which can overwhelm your system regardless of timing.

Pair your chocolate with protein or healthy fats to slow absorption. A piece of dark chocolate with almonds or after a protein-rich breakfast creates steady energy rather than spikes.
